    Overview of "tops and bottoms" - tops and bottoms, clothes are skirts. The top and bottom are one of the earliest clothing forms in China, and the first style of the Hanfu system.

    Ancient documents and excavated human-shaped pottery prove that the shape of the upper and lower garments was formed in the Shang Dynasty at the latest. Tops and bottoms were later called "kits". Because it is convenient for labor, it is mostly worn by working people.

    Tops and bottoms"history and evolution.

    During the Shang Dynasty, according to research, there was a system of tops and bottoms, which were divided into regular clothes and formal dresses. At that time, the sleeves were shorter and the clothes were narrower.

    In the Western Zhou Dynasty, regular clothes were still the mainstream of tops and bottoms. The style of the garment remains the same, but gradually widens, and the sleeves become larger and larger, forming a style with large sleeves and a dismantling coat.

    During the Spring and Autumn Period and the Warring States Period, regular clothes and dresses were still made of tops and bottoms, which became more and more exquisite. Large sleeves were only used as dresses at this time.

    During the Qin and Han dynasties, folk clothes were coexisted with the top-and-bottom system and the deep coat system (the second style in the Hanfu system), but the deep clothes have gradually replaced the tops and bottoms to become the mainstream. At this time, the dress is wider than before.

    During the Wei and Jin dynasties, the tops and bottoms in the regular clothes were no longer favored by people. Due to the influence of some ideological trends, the clothes became wider and more elegant, and the sleeves became more and more open in the style of the Wei and Jin dynasties.

    The five dynasties of the Sui and Tang dynasties still existed, but they were in decline.

    Style description: "Clothing" is sewn with sleeves, front open clothing, the right cover of the placket is called the right side, and the left cover of the placket is called the left side.

    In the beginning, the cloth was only cut into two pieces around the body, and in the Han Dynasty, the front and back pieces began to be connected to become a tube, which is now called "skirt".

    Xia Shang third generation: top and bottom, hair tied on the right side.

    Spring and Autumn Warring States: Deep clothes and hufu.

    Qin and Han dynasties: Women wore short undergarments and long skirts, and their knees were decorated with long drooping belts.

    Wei Jin: Women's long skirts are swaying to the ground, with large sleeves and layered ribbons.

    Northern and Southern Dynasties: Women are wrapped in white scarves on their heads (a kind of headscarf with a green ribbon, legend has it that Zhuge Liang usually wears this headscarf during the Three Kingdoms), the sleeves are long and narrow and carved with wisps, and the dress style is mainly skirted, and women especially wear skirts as orthodox.

    Sui and Tang Dynasties: **It is mainly composed of skirts, shirts, and curtains. At this time, the shirt is often hidden under the skirt, so the skirt looks very long. The veil is also known as the drapery, like a long, thin shawl. In the early Tang Dynasty, it was also popular to wear clothes such as curly brimmed hats and lapel coats.

    Song Dynasty: Women wore skirts and shirts, and the shirts at this time were mostly plackets and covered over the skirts. The skirt is narrower, more fine folding, in addition to the Luo skirt in the Yellow Tomb of Fuzhou, there are open crotch pants and crotch pants, it can be seen that the women of the Song Dynasty wore pants in the skirt.

    Yuan Dynasty: The women's clothing of the Yuan Dynasty was divided into two styles: nobles and commoners. Most of the nobles were Mongolians, and leather clothes and hats were used as national clothes, and mink and sheepskin clothing were more extensive. Commoner women wore Han skirts, and half-arms were also quite popular, and the narrow-sleeved shirts and hats of the Tang Dynasty were also preserved.

    Ming Dynasty: Women wear "backs" daily, the backs are mostly collared or straight-collared, the length of the dress is the same as the skirt, the left and right armpits are open, the placket is open, there are no buttons on both sides, and sometimes they are tied with ropes. Aristocratic women wore a full-collared style with large sleeves, while commoner women wore a straight-necked and small-sleeved style.

    Qing Dynasty: Manchu women wore Manchu-style flag suits, they did not bind their feet, did not tie their skirts, and wore cheongsam, sometimes with their shoulders. Han Chinese women still wear tops and bottoms in fashion.

    Curved deep coat and skirt.

    In the Han Dynasty, the curved deep coat was not only worn by men, but also the most common type of clothing among women, which was tight and narrow throughout, long and draggable, and the hem was generally trumpet-shaped, and the line was not exposed. The sleeves are wide and narrow, the cuffs are mostly trimmed, and the collar part is very distinctive, usually with a cross-collar, and the neckline is very low so as to expose the undergarment.

    In addition, the Han Dynasty narrow-sleeved tight-fitting deep clothes, the clothes have been turned several times, around the hips, and then tied with silk belts, the clothes are also painted with exquisite and gorgeous patterns, the deep clothes are worn to wrap the body and move inconveniently, and are slowly replaced by straight-lined clothes.

    The skirt is one of the most important forms of Chinese women's clothing, and the style of women's clothing with upper skirt and lower skirt has appeared as early as the Warring States Period. By the Han Dynasty, due to the widespread popularity of deep clothing, the number of women wearing this style of clothing gradually decreased. The skirt style of this period was generally very short at the top, reaching only to the waist, while the skirt was very long and drooped to the ground.

    The costume patterns of the Han Dynasty were varied and full of mythology. In the Han Dynasty, the color of clothing patterns was mainly contrasted, emphasizing brightness, eye-catching, and gorgeousness, showing the characteristics of beauty in plain beauty.

    The Han Dynasty spanned two dynasties and four hundred years, ** clothing has the characteristics of collar, right side, tie, wide sleeves, various styles, etc., from the existing cultural relics, the most popular styles are as follows:

    1. Temple clothes: equivalent to the Zhou Dynasty's clothes, it is the most noble one of the women's dresses. The queen mother, the queen mother's temple clothes, the queen's temple clothes, the color of their clothes is soap.

    2. Silkworm clothing: equivalent to the Zhou Dynasty about bow clothes. In March every year, the queen marshal leads the princesses and wives to wear silkworm ceremonies.

    3. Court clothes: From Mrs. 2,000 Shi to the queen bureau Zheng, all use silkworm clothes as court clothes.
